What is Editor Eye StandAlone?
Editor Eye StandAlone is a Unity MCP (Model Context Protocol) server that gives AI assistants real visual feedback inside the Unity Editor. It screenshots the Game and Scene views, drives Play Mode with simulated keyboard/mouse input, steers SceneView cameras, inspects the UI, and runs C# code live — enabling AI to visually QA and play-test games rather than guessing at results. It is for Unity developers using AI coding assistants like Claude Code, Cursor, or Claude Desktop.

Key features of Editor Eye StandAlone
- Visual QA — acts on the actual rendered frame, not a guess
- Play-test automation — runs and plays your game build
- 65 tools across scene, assets, animation, physics, and VRChat
- Local and buy-once — no cloud, no subscription, no login required
- Works with Claude Code, Cursor, Claude Desktop, and other MCP clients
- Supports Windows and Unity 2022.3+
Use cases of Editor Eye StandAlone
- Automatically visually QA game builds by capturing and analyzing frames
- Drive Play Mode with simulated input to play-test levels and mechanics
- Inspect and manipulate the Unity UI hierarchy through live screenshots
- Steer SceneView cameras to frame and review 3D scenes
- Run and iterate on C# scripts in real time within the editor
